Zona Franca Romana
Zona Franca Romana is a Free Trade Zone located in La Romana, Dominican Republic, established in 1969, regulated by the National Council of Free Zones (CNZFE).
Key Facts
| Type | Free Trade Zone |
|---|---|
| Location | La Romana, Dominican Republic |
| Year Established | 1969 |
| Companies | 130 |
| Governing Authority | National Council of Free Zones (CNZFE) |
| Status | active |
Investment Incentives
Corporate tax holiday, duty-free imports, streamlined customs procedures, no VAT on exports, exemption from municipal taxes
Sector Focus
Zona Franca Romana hosts businesses specialising in Logistics.
About Zona Franca Romana
Zona Franca Romana specializes in textile manufacturing and export, contributing significantly to the local economy and job market.
